Abstract

This Application sets forth techniques for identifying when a vetted software application transitions into providing unauthorized features. In particular, the techniques involve identifying original operating characteristics of a software application during a vetting process that is performed by a management entity (and/or other vetting entities). The vetting process produces a vetted software application, which includes information about the original operating characteristics of the software application. The vetted software application is then distributed and installed onto computing devices. In turn, computing devices that execute the vetted software application can gather its current operating characteristics and compare them to the original operating characteristics to identify any anomalies. Appropriate action can then be taken, such as notifying the management entity and/or terminating the execution of the vetted software application.
